A sonic boom is a sound associated with shock waves created when an object travels through the air faster than the speed of sound. Sonic booms generate enormous amounts of sound energy, sounding similar to an explosion or a thunderclap to the human ear. WebJan 27, 2024 · The optical equivalent of a sonic boom has been filmed for the first time. The feat involved two important breakthroughs, slowing the light to create the effect and developing an ultrafast imaging technique to record the phenomenon. WebS ONIC BOOMS are explosive sounds that occur without warning. Sometimes annoying because of their startle effects and their ability to shake buildings, these sounds pose a unique problem for the orderly development of high‐speed air transport. Although booms from military aircraft are widely observed around the world, the real concern is for ...
